1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 | #include <stdio.h> int main(){ int i,j,temp,a[3]; scanf("%d %d %d",&a[0] ,&a[1] ,&a[2]); if(a[0] != 0 && a[1] != 0 && a[2] != 0){ for(i=0;i<=2;i++){ for(j=0;j<2-i;j++){ if(a[j] > a[j+1]){ temp = a[j]; a[j] = a[j+1]; a[j+1] = temp; } } } if((a[2]*a[2]) == ((a[1]*a[1])+(a[0]*a[0]))){ printf("right\n"); } else{ printf("wrong\n"); } scanf("%d %d %d",&a[0] ,&a[1] ,&a[2]); } return 0; } |
I2luY2x1ZGUgPHN0ZGlvLmg+CiAKaW50IG1haW4oKXsKICAgICAgICBpbnQgaSxqLHRlbXAsYVszXTsKICAgICAgICBzY2FuZigiJWQgJWQgJWQiLCZhWzBdICwmYVsxXSAsJmFbMl0pOwogICAgICAgIGlmKGFbMF0gIT0gMCAmJiBhWzFdICE9IDAgJiYgYVsyXSAhPSAwKXsKCQlmb3IoaT0wO2k8PTI7aSsrKXsKICAgICAgICAgICAgICAgICAgICAgICAgZm9yKGo9MDtqPDItaTtqKyspewogIC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gIGlmKGFbal0gPiBhW2orMV0pewogIC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gdGVtcCA9IGFbal07CiA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ICBhW2pdID0gYVtqKzFdOwogIC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gYVtqKzFdID0gdGVtcDsKICAgICAgICAgICAgICAgICAgICAgICAgICAgICAgICB9CiAgICAgICAgICAgICAgICAgICAgICAgIH0KICAgICAgICAgICAgICAgIH0KICAgICAgICAgICAgICAgIGlmKChhWzJdKmFbMl0pID09ICgoYVsxXSphWzFdKSsoYVswXSphWzBdKSkpewogICAgICAgICAgICAgICAgICAgICAgICBwcmludGYoInJpZ2h0XG4iKTsKICAgICAgICAgICAgICAgIH0KICAgICAgICAgICAgICAgIGVsc2V7CiAgICAgICAgICAgICAgICAgICAgICAgIHByaW50Zigid3JvbmdcbiIpOwogICAgICAgICAgICAgICAgfQogICAgICAgICAgICAgICAgc2NhbmYoIiVkICVkICVkIiwmYVswXSAsJmFbMV0gLCZhWzJdKTsKICAgICAgICB9CiAgICAgICAgcmV0dXJuIDA7Cn0=
-
upload with new input
-
result: Success time: 0.01s memory: 1724 kB returned value: 0
6 8 10 25 52 60 5 12 13 0 0 0
right
-
result: Success time: 0.01s memory: 1724 kB returned value: 0
wrong



